Alison Oxtoby

Practice Areas: • Estate & Trusts • Corporate/Commercial • Owner-Managed

Business • Business Succession • Tax

Education: • LLB, 1996, UVic • BA, 1992, UWO • In-Depth Tax Course CICA, 2003 Year of Call/Admission: British Columbia, 1997

Alison Oxtoby is a Kelowna lawyer with a practice focusing on estates and trusts, corporate transactions and tax-driven reorganizations. She has been practicing for 20 years and works with individuals and both owner-managed and family businesses on a wide range of matters, such as:

• basic estate and incapacity planning (wills, powers of attorneys and health care representation agreements)

• complex estate plans involving tax-planned wills with multiple trusts, multiple wills, alter ego trusts, joint partner trusts, family trusts, deeds of gift, declarations of trust, life insurance trusts, and other advanced probate planning, and strategies to address potential future incapacity

• tax-driven reorganizations such as estate freezes and other tax-deferred transfers of property • incorporations (including incorporations for professionals governed by regulatory bodies) • transactional corporate/commercial matters • estate administration

Alison obtained her law degree from the University of Victoria in 1996. She was a partner and worked for 12 years with a large full-service national firm in Vancouver before moving to the Okanagan in 2007. There she worked for several years advising high net worth clients of a private bank before founding Entrust Lawyers LLP with one other lawyer.

Alison has worked for individuals, families and for public and private companies in a wide variety of sectors, including forestry, mining, construction, retail, transportation and public utilities. She has acted for various family-owned enterprises and has also served on charitable boards.

Alison was a co-editor and contributing author of the Annotated British Columbia Business Corporations Act, published by Canada Law Book. She has also authored papers for, and made presentations to, the Continuing Legal Education Society of BC (CLE), the Canadian Bar Association, the Chartered

Professional Accountants of BC, the Society of Trust and Estate Practitioners (STEP), Federated Press and the Law Society’s Professional Legal Training Program. She has also lectured at both the University of Victoria and University of British Columbia law schools and she regularly teaches courses for Okanagan College’s Continuing Education Program.
